Verizon
 1 Out of 5
Phone Model: LG5400 |
Bellona / Gittings, Baltimore, MD 21212 |
Sat Oct 15, 2011 |
Dead. Had Verizon for 10+ years with no problems. Then we moved to Pinehurst and there is no signal. 0-1 bars in my house / outside. Impossible to use so I'm searching for another carrier. Its kinda weird that they have such a huge dead zone just 2 miles from downtown Towson.

Verizon
 4 Out of 5
Phone Model: LG Dare |
Federal Hill, Baltimore, MD 21230 |
Sun Oct 17, 2010 |
Incredibly strong and reliable reception, even in basements. Never, ever had a dropped call (lived here 4 years). In fact, excellent coverage (including data) throughout Baltimore. Only place I've had problems in Baltimore is in a subway station far below ground (wish Verizon had coverage there like they do for the subway in Washington, D.C.).

Verizon
 0 Out of 5
Phone Model: LG VX6000
|
Greenspring Ave. / Willowglen Ave., Baltimore, MD 21209 |
Thu Mar 24, 2005 |
I have Verizon and have terrible reception. I used to barely eek out reception in my apartment, occasionally getting 2-3 bars on a good day, but now, can barely get one bar, and even then, calls drop out in the middle of connecting routinely, etc. Retrieving voice mail is an exercise in futility. My Verizon coverage, strangely enough, has actually gottten worse. Same location, same phone - but my bars are now pretty much gone, even within a few block radius. T-Mobile works best in my area, of so I've heard. Haven't tried Cingular / AT&T but am considering it, since across the board, the performance of Verizon, everywhere I go is increadingly spotty and unreliable, with drop-outs, echoes, and sudden drops from 5-6 bars to none with no warning. Verizon definitely is starting to show reliability problems for me. (Of course, at work, they installed a Verizon antenna, so it works there. To bad it stinks every where else seemingly.)

Verizon
 5 Out of 5
Phone Model: Samsung SCH-A670
|
Charles St.& Preston, Baltimore, MD 21201 |
Wed Feb 16, 2005 |
I just switched from the SCH-A530 to the A670. My older phone overall had better reception, but the service is still great. I get a great signal throughout the city, and wherever I travel. I rarely have dropped calls. Also, when I'm in a city's subway system, including Baltimores, I always get a full signal. I think Verizon is still the only company that offers underground cell phone reception.
